Raw material sourcing sets the tone for finished product quality as well as factory margins. In China, firms respond quickly to fluctuations in amino acid powder and peptide costs, thanks to both strategic reserves and nimble procurement teams with long-term relationships among Liaoning, Hubei, and even international suppliers as needed. Domestic availability of crucial inputs like tryptophan, valine, lysine, and methionine allows rapid adjustment when market conditions shift. By contrast, manufacturers in the United States, Germany, Switzerland, Saudi Arabia, and the Netherlands experience more erratic supply, often dependent on overseas shipments. Natural disasters, geopolitical strains, and even transport backlogs in ports such as Rotterdam and Houston shoot up the landed costs and delay deliveries. Over the last two years, the average FOB price for Compound Amino Acid Injection from China fell by nearly 4-6%, while the same products from Italy, Switzerland, or the United States crept up by at least 7-10%. This spread widens as global logistics continue to see disruptions. Even regions with a long history in pharmaceuticals, such as Japan, France, Russia, and Spain, find it tough to match the agility of Chinese suppliers in securing bulk stock when a sudden surge in orders triggers a scramble for raw materials.

Pharmaceutical buyers in the largest markets, such as the US, Germany, France, Canada, South Korea, Australia, and Japan, expect full compliance with Good Manufacturing Practice from every factory. Chinese manufacturers now operate under a strict GMP regime, validated by both domestic and international agencies. Over the last decade, our factory teams have built deep institutional knowledge in validation protocols, batch documentation, and traceability, tightening standards to match or exceed those seen in Italy, Switzerland, and South Korea. GMP-certified production lines in Chinese plants benefit from modern automation, real-time batch monitoring, and painstakingly precise environmental controls. This results in narrower variation in amino acid blend ratios vial-to-vial. Older factories in some global markets, particularly in Turkey, Thailand, Indonesia, or South Africa, struggle with outdated infrastructure or inconsistent staff training, occasionally letting batch deviation slip – even if unintentionally. Chinese manufacturers see this as motivation to invest in sharper process controls, especially as regulatory scrutiny rises from importing countries.
